Distributed Cooperative Control and Optimization for Multi-Agent Systems

Distributed Cooperative Control and Optimization for Multi-Agent Systems

Qing Wang; Bin Xin; Jie Chen

Springer Nature Switzerland AG
2025
sidottu
This book provides a concise and in-depth exposition of distributed control and optimization problems of multi-agent systems. The book integrates various ideas and tools from dynamic systems, control theory, graph theory, and optimization to address the special challenges posed by such complexities in the environment as communication delay, topological dynamics, and environmental uncertainties. In order to deal with the mismatched uncertainties and time delay, observer-based controller and sliding mode control are developed to achieve consensus control. When there is a leader or multiple leaders in the communication topologies, containment control is required. The book studies both state and output containment for nonlinear multi-agent systems with undirected or directed networks. Furthermore, event-triggered schemes are proposed to reduce communication and computation costs. Distributed optimization for multi-agent systems is an interesting topic that has attracted more and more attention due to its wide range of applications such as smart grids, sensor networks, and mobile manipulators. In distributed optimization, the goal is to optimize the global cost function, which is the sum of all local cost functions, each of which is known only by its own local agent. Distributed nonsmooth convex optimization for multi-agent systems based on proximal operators is developed to achieve distributed optimal consensus.
Decomposition-based Evolutionary Optimization In Complex Environments

Decomposition-based Evolutionary Optimization In Complex Environments

Juan Li; Bin Xin; Jie Chen

World Scientific Publishing Co Pte Ltd
2020
sidottu
Multi-objective optimization problems (MOPs) and uncertain optimization problems (UOPs) which widely exist in real life are challengeable problems in the fields of decision making, system designing, and scheduling, amongst others. Decomposition exploits the ideas of ‘making things simple’ and ‘divide and conquer’ to transform a complex problem into a series of simple ones with the aim of reducing the computational complexity. In order to tackle the abovementioned two types of complicated optimization problems, this book introduces the decomposition strategy and conducts a systematic study to perfect the usage of decomposition in the field of multi-objective optimization, and extend the usage of decomposition in the field of uncertain optimization.
Limits of Stability and Stabilization of Time-Delay Systems

Limits of Stability and Stabilization of Time-Delay Systems

Jing Zhu; Tian Qi; Dan Ma; Jie Chen

Springer International Publishing AG
2019
nidottu
This authored monograph presents a study on fundamental limits and robustness of stability and stabilization of time-delay systems, with an emphasis on time-varying delay, robust stabilization, and newly emerged areas such as networked control and multi-agent systems. The authors systematically develop an operator-theoretic approach that departs from both the traditional algebraic approach and the currently pervasive LMI solution methods. This approach is built on the classical small-gain theorem, which enables the author to draw upon powerful tools and techniques from robust control theory. The book contains motivating examples and presents mathematical key facts that are required in the subsequent sections. The target audience primarily comprises researchers and professionals in the field of control theory, but the book may also be beneficial for graduate students alike.

Stability of Time-Delay Systems

Stability of Time-Delay Systems

Keqin Gu; Vladimir L. Kharitonov; Jie Chen

Springer-Verlag New York Inc.
2012
nidottu
This monograph is a self-contained, coherent presentation of the background and progress of the stability of time-delay systems. Focusing on techniques, tools, and advances in numerical methods and optimization algorithms, the authors developed material which, up until now, has been scattered in technical journals and conference proceedings. Special emphasis is placed on systems with uncertainty and stability criteria which can be computationally implemented. The second edition is major update to reflect the state of art in this field greatly expanding on the original material in addition to two new chapters on Systems of Neutral Type and an Introduction to Frequency Domain Method. Requiring only basic knowledge of linear systems and Lyapunov stability theory, Stability of Time-Delay Systems, 2nd ed is accessible to a broad audience of researchers, professional engineers, and graduate students. It may be used for self-study or as a reference; portions of the text may be used in advanced graduate courses and seminars.
Shi Cheng

Shi Cheng

Han Dong; Zhu Wen; Jie Chen

Comma Press
2012
nidottu
To the West, China may appear an unstoppable economic unity, a single high-performing whole, but for the inhabitants of this vast, complex, and contradictory nation, it is the cities that hold the secret to such economic success. From the affluent, Westernized Hong Kong to the ice-cold Harbin in the north, from the Islamic quarters of Xi'an to the manufacturing powerhouse of Guangzhou--China's cities thrum with promise and aspiration, playing host to the myriad hopes, frustrations, and tensions that define China today. The stories in this anthology offer snapshots of 10 such cities, taking in as many different types of inhabitant. Here we meet the lowly Beijing mechanic lovingly piecing together his first car from scrap metal, somnambulant commuters at a Nanjing bus stop refusing to acknowledge the presence of a dead body just feet away, or Shenyang intellectuals conducting a letter-writing campaign on the moral welfare of their city. The challenges depicted in these stories are uniquely Chinese, but the energy and ingenuity with which their authors approach them is something readers everywhere can marvel at. Featuring stories from locations including Beijing, Chengdu, Guangzhou, Harbin, Hong Kong, Nanjing, Shanghai, Shenyang, Wuhan, and Xi'an, the collection contains work from authors Jie Chen, Han Dong, Diao Dou, Cau Kou, Ding Liying, Ho Sin Tung, Yi Sha, Zhu Wen, Xu Zechen, and Zhang Zhihao.

The Overseas Chinese Democracy Movement

The Overseas Chinese Democracy Movement

Jie Chen

Edward Elgar Publishing Ltd
2019
sidottu
The overseas Chinese democracy movement (OCDM) is one of the world's longest-running and most difficult exile political campaigns. This unique book is a rare and comprehensive account of its trajectory since its beginnings in the early 1980s, examining its shifting operational environment and the diversification of its activities, as well as characterizing its distinctive features in comparison to other exile movements. Chen Jie takes an empirical approach to the history of the OCDM, drawing on extensive primary sources and his own significant field research, including interviews with major dissident figures. He explores the changing roles of activists since the events of Tiananmen Square and the movement's subsequent heyday, highlighting the diverse positions occupied today as a result of internal division and evolving geopolitical circumstances. Using the analytical framework of exile politics, Chen also examines such issues as China's relationship with Taiwan and the implications of the expanding global Chinese diaspora.Academics and postgraduate students studying Chinese politics and international relations, as well as those with an interest in diaspora studies, will find this book invaluable. It will also provide important understanding of Chinese exiles and activists to government officials and those working in international political foundations, funding bodies and human rights organisations.

Missing and Modified Data in Nonparametric Estimation

Missing and Modified Data in Nonparametric Estimation

Jie Chen; Joseph Heyse; Tze Leung Lai

CRC Press
2018
sidottu
This book presents a systematic and unified approach for modern nonparametric treatment of missing and modified data via examples of density and hazard rate estimation, nonparametric regression, filtering signals, and time series analysis. All basic types of missing at random and not at random, biasing, truncation, censoring, and measurement errors are discussed, and their treatment is explained. Ten chapters of the book cover basic cases of direct data, biased data, nondestructive and destructive missing, survival data modified by truncation and censoring, missing survival data, stationary and nonstationary time series and processes, and ill-posed modifications.The coverage is suitable for self-study or a one-semester course for graduate students with a prerequisite of a standard course in introductory probability. Exercises of various levels of difficulty will be helpful for the instructor and self-study.The book is primarily about practically important small samples. It explains when consistent estimation is possible, and why in some cases missing data should be ignored and why others must be considered. If missing or data modification makes consistent estimation impossible, then the author explains what type of action is needed to restore the lost information.The book contains more than a hundred figures with simulated data that explain virtually every setting, claim, and development. The companion R software package allows the reader to verify, reproduce and modify every simulation and used estimators. A Middle Class Without Democracy

A Middle Class Without Democracy

Jie Chen

Oxford University Press Inc
2014
nidottu
What kind of role can the middle class play in potential democratization in such an undemocratic, late developing country as China? To answer this profound political as well as theoretical question, Jie Chen explores attitudinal and behavioral orientation of China's new middle class to democracy and democratization. Chen's work is based on a unique set of data collected from a probability-sample survey and in-depth interviews of residents in three major Chinese cities, Beijing, Chengdu and Xi'an--each of which represents a distinct level of economic development in urban China-in 2007 and 2008. The empirical findings derived from this data set confirm that (1) compared to other social classes, particularly lower classes, the new Chinese middle class-especially those employed in the state apparatus-tends to be more supportive of the current Party-state but less supportive of democratic values and institutions; (2) the new middle class's attitudes toward democracy may be accounted for by this class's close ideational and institutional ties with the state, and its perceived socioeconomic wellbeing, among other factors; (3) the lack of support for democracy among the middle class tends to cause this social class to act in favor of the current state but in opposition to democratic changes. The most important political implication is that while China's middle class is not likely to serve as the harbinger of democracy now, its current attitudes toward democracy may change in the future. Such a crucial shift in the middle class's orientation toward democracy can take place, especially when its dependence on the Party-state decreases and perception of its own social and economic statuses turns pessimistic. The key theoretical implication from the findings suggests that the attitudinal and behavioral orientations of the middle class-as a whole and as a part-toward democratic change in late developing countries are contingent upon its with the incumbent state and its perceived social/economic wellbeing, and the middle class's support for democracy in these countries is far from inevitable.
Housing Affordability and Housing Policy in Urban China

Housing Affordability and Housing Policy in Urban China

Zan Yang; Jie Chen

Springer-Verlag Berlin and Heidelberg GmbH Co. K
2014
nidottu
This book provides a comprehensive analysis of housing affordability under the economic reforms and social transformations in urban China. It also offers an overall review of the current government measures on the housing market and affordable housing policies in China. By introducing a dynamic affordability approach and residual income approach, the book allows us to capture the size of the affordability gap more accurately, to better identify policy targets, and to assess the effectiveness of current public policy. The unique database on urban household surveys and regional information on affordable housing projects serve to strengthen the analysis. The book offers theoretical and empirical insights for in-depth affordability studies and helps readers to understand the social impacts of market reforms and the role of government on the Chinese housing market.
